Leadership Review Briefing — Veltria Region Expansion

For the finance team: Ostenmark Group intends to enter the Veltria region in the second half of next year. Initial scope covers two distribution hubs and a lean commercial office. Capital requirements fall within the approved expansion reserve; working capital needs are under modelling. Regulatory filings are on track. The executive committee has attached the following note on related plans.

management briefing: Project Ulavan slips by two quarters because of the staffing delay.

**Ticket #4417 — Load-test vault locked, blocking checkout plugin certification**

The Crateline load-testing vault sealed itself after three failed sync attempts, so external plugin authors can't pull synthetic checkout credentials for the Harvex storefront flow. Certification runs are paused until it's reopened. To unseal, run the vault's local recovery tool on the staging host and enter the recovery passphrase below.

recovery phrase for yagap-kawip: wenael-quenix

# Break-Glass: Catalog Cache Invalidation

Scope: the Pinrow product catalog at Veldstone Retail. If stale prices persist after a purge and the Hollowmere invalidation queue is wedged, use break-glass to flush the edge tier directly. Contractors: get verbal sign-off from the catalog lead first. Steps: open the Hollowmere admin shell, select emergency-flush, confirm the tenant, and run it once — repeated flushes thrash the origin. Access is logged and expires after 20 minutes. Unseal the admin shell with the passphrase below.

recovery phrase for kahop-tajog: istix-casvan

## Runbook: SQL Lint Gate — Project Quillbase

Before cutting a release, the `quill-lint` job must pass on all `.sql` files under `migrations/`. Rules enforce lowercase keywords, explicit column lists, and banned `SELECT *`. Lint rule updates ship as a signed ruleset bundle so environments stay consistent. Build the bundle with `make ruleset`, then the pipeline signs and uploads it. Future maintainers rotating the signer should update this page. The ruleset bundles are signed with the following deploy key.

release key, hadug-kawef: bky13_mPGeFZeR1GZ1G